Barracuda RMM prior 2025.1.1 Service Center path traversal

Summary
A vulnerability described as critical has been identified in Barracuda RMM. The impacted element is an unknown function of the component Service Center. Such manipulation leads to path traversal. This vulnerability is documented as CVE-2025-34395. The attack can be executed remotely. There is not any exploit available. Upgrading the affected component is recommended.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Barracuda RMM and classified as critical. Affected by this issue is an unknown code block of the component Service Center.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a path traversal v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-22. The product uses external input to construct a pathname that is intended to identify a file or directory that is located underneath a restricted parent directory, but the product does not properly neutralize special elements within the pathname that can cause the pathname to resolve to a location that is outside of the restricted directory. Impacted is confidentiality. CVE summarizes:
Barracuda Service Center, as implemented in the RMM solution, in versions prior to 2025.1.1, exposes a .NET Remoting service in which an unauthenticated attacker can invoke a method vulnerable to path traversal to read arbitrary files. This vulnerability can be escalated to remote code execution by retrieving the .NET machine keys.
The weakness was released by Piotr Bazydlo. The advisory is available at download.mw-rmm.barracudamsp.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2025-34395 since 04/15/2025.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be launched remotely.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available. This vulnerability is assigned to T1006 by the MITRE ATT&CK project.
Upgrading to version 2025.1.1 eliminates this vulnerability.
